If the Proxy Manager is used to perform end user response management or service operation management, perform the following operations on the Proxy Manager.
Refer to "Managing End User Response" in the User's Guide for information about end user response management, and "Service Operation Management" in the User's Guide for information about service operation management.
Install a Proxy Manager
Install a Proxy Manager by referring to "3.1.2 Installing an Agent/Proxy Manager".
Switch the Agent from Push to Pull.
Switch the Agent from Push to Pull by referring to "4.4.3.2 Tasks to perform on the Agent or Proxy Manager".
Set up a Pull communication environment for the Proxy Manager
Execute the sqcSetFileSec command by referring to "4.4.2 Setting up a Pull Communication Environment".
Set up the Proxy Manager for redundant Manager operation.
Set up the Proxy Manager for redundant Manager operation by referring to "A.5 Agent/Proxy Manager Setup Command for Redundant Manager Operation".
Set up the Proxy Manager
Point
Set up the Proxy Manager if the Agent function is to be used on the Proxy Manager to collect performance information about the Proxy Manager itself.
Execute the sqcRPolicy and sqcSetPolicy commands by referring to "A.1 Server Resource Information Collection Policy Creation Command".
Start the Proxy Manager service or daemon and confirm that it operates normally.
Start the service or daemon by referring to "A.8 How to Start and Stop Resident Processes". Also check that the resident processes have started correctly.
